Life Cycle Assessment (LCA) is a tool which quantitatively analyzes and qualitatively valuates the environmental impact of a product, process or activity throughout its entire life cycle. It can distinguish and quantify this impact through utilization of substances and environmental wastes. The purpose is to valuate environmental impact of these factors and search for a chance to improve. At the present time, all kinds of international social aspects pay attention to the development and application of life cycle assessment. It is expected that LCA will be a technique of environmental management with the most vitality and development future in this century.According to the technical framework of life cycle assessment, this paper first applies it to the field of the products of synthesized polymer biomedical material. A set of life cycle assessment model which is suitable to this kind of products is brought up in this paper and is used to analyze and valuate resource depletion and environment influence in life cycle of fracture internal fixation screw manufactured by Chengdu Dikang biomedical material corp. Ltd, including three parts: goals and scoping, inventory analysis and life cycle impact assessment. In result, two important assessment indices are gotten: resource depletion index and environmental load index. Furthermore, it is identified that photochemical ozone creation is the most important type to environment influence in the product life cycle, gas and coal are the main depletion factors, and the stage of product manufacture is the most useful stage to environmental load and resource depletion in the whole life cycle. All of the research results can be used not only to direct enterprise's production and environmental management but also to provide proof for department of environmental management to decide relative environmental protect rules.
